Life, A Chance For Living

I thought to climb the mountain
then thought
why any need for atop?

Could just stay in a valley
where, less chance of a smashing
flop!

And if I flew, some aircraft of sort -- 
passenger, better chance I could safely 
have same view -- 

Nah! What the heck!

Break-a-leg, as they say in the theater

The captain may down with his ship

trapeze artist, chance a deadly slip

I will perish someday, anyway~ if

not by faulty rope, a bad performance, a
capsizing storm, or poorly timed flip --
